Ingredients
For the Beef Roast
- 3 pounds beef chuck roast or brisket
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 tablespoon unsalted butter
- 1 large onion, sliced
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- 3 cups beef broth
- 2 tablespoons tomato paste
- 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me
- 1 teaspoon dried rosemary
- 1 teaspoon paprika
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
For the Vegetables and Gravy
- 1 pound baby potatoes, halved if large
- 4 carrots, peeled and cut into chunks
- 2 tablespoons cornstarch mixed with 3 tablespoons water, optional for thickening
- Fresh parsley, chopped, for garnish
Time and Servings
- Prep Time: 20 minutes
- Cooking Time: 4 hours
- Total Time: 4 hours 20 minutes
- Servings: 6
- Calories: About 560 kcal per serving
Instructions
Start by patting the beef roast dry with paper towels. This helps it brown beautifully in the pot. Season all sides with salt, black pepper, paprika, dried thyme, and dried rosemary.
Heat the olive oil and butter in a large Dutch oven over medium-high heat. Once the pot is hot, add the beef and sear it for 4 to 5 minutes per side. Let it get deeply browned before turning it. Those golden edges are where so much of the flavor begins.
Remove the roast from the pot and set it aside for a moment.
In the same pot, add the sliced onion. Cook for 3 to 4 minutes, stirring now and then, until the onion softens and starts to smell sweet and savory. Add the minced garlic and cook for about 30 seconds, just until fragrant.
Stir in the tomato paste, beef broth, and Worcestershire sauce. As you stir, scrape the bottom of the pot to lift up all those browned bits from searing the beef. They will melt into the broth and make the gravy rich and flavorful.
Return the roast to the pot. Cover and let it simmer gently over low heat for 2 1/2 to 3 hours. You can also place the covered Dutch oven in a 325°F (165°C) oven if you prefer. Either way, let it cook slowly until the beef becomes tender.
Add the potatoes and carrots around the roast. Cover the pot again and cook for another 45 to 60 minutes, or until the vegetables are soft and the beef is tender enough to slice easily.
Carefully remove the beef and vegetables from the pot. If you would like a thicker gravy, stir in the cornstarch slurry and let the liquid simmer for 3 to 5 minutes, until it thickens.
Slice the beef against the grain. Serve it with the tender potatoes, carrots, and plenty of warm gravy spooned over the top.
Finish with a sprinkle of fresh parsley for a little color and freshness.

For a cozy family-style meal, place the sliced beef on a large serving platter and arrange the potatoes and carrots around it. Spoon some gravy over the top so everything looks glossy and inviting.
A sprinkle of chopped parsley gives the dish a fresh, simple finish. You can also serve extra gravy in a small bowl or pitcher on the side, because someone will definitely want more.
This roast pairs beautifully with warm dinner rolls, buttered bread, green beans, or a simple salad. It is also wonderful served straight from the Dutch oven for that rustic, home-cooked feeling.
